Norwegian Rallied in Support of Afghans and against the Taliban

  • Nimrokh Media
  • August 20, 2022

Norwegian citizens rallied in support of the Afghan people and against the Taliban group

Norwegian citizens in Europe organized a civil march in support of the people of Afghanistan and against the terrorist operations of the Taliban group.

One of the female Afghan protesters living in Norway sent a video and photos of the march and said: “These protesters were chanting “Taliban are terrorists” and “Stop the genocide of Hazaras, Sikhs, and Tajiks!”

Also, the protesting citizens of Norway have condemned the gender discrimination policy of the Taliban group and declared their support for the women’s civil protests against the Taliban.

Meanwhile, on the first anniversary of the fall of Afghanistan to the Taliban group, protest programs against the Taliban group and in support of the country’s women were held in various cities of Europe, the US, Australia, and the countries of the region.

The main message of the civil demonstrations inside and outside the country was to prevent the recognition of the Taliban regime and protect the human rights of citizens, especially women, under the control of the Taliban group.
